Canyon Crest Country Club is the premier destination for a championship golf experience and family-friendly amenities in the Riverside community. Designed in 1968 by two-time major champion Olin Dutra, our well-known course features five sets of tees, ensuring it’s both challenging and fun for all skill levels. This historic club has proudly hosted prestigious events, including amateur and junior golf championships, high school CIF competitions, and professional events with the SCPGA. Legendary champions like Tiger Woods and Brandie Burton have played here. Serving as a true Riverside staple, Canyon Crest is a home course for local schools and a venue for charitable tournaments. ESSENTIAL PURPOSE: To manage the staff and operations of the Golf Maintenance Department, to ensure first class quality functional and aesthetic standards while maintaining the highest possible levels of employee morale. ESSENTIAL DUTIES:
JOB KNOWLEDGE & EDUCATIONAL LEVEL: AA Degree in horticulture, turf management, or equivalent experience, required. Must have minimum four years experience in golf course maintenance, including at least one year in supervisory position. English fluency required. Spanish fluency helpful. Must have knowledge of all aspects of turf grass management and related equipment, to include latest technology and new products. Experience in management of POA greens is required. Experienced in irrigation system repair and construction, development of annual budget, employee supervision, and inventory control. Familiar with local Department of Health regulations, and current relevant laws governing handling of hazardous substances. SKILLS AND APTITUDES: Demonstrated ability to train staff and ensure luxury resort customer service. Strong written and verbal communications skills. Organized and efficient. Safety-minded. Good team player. Detail oriented. Highly self-motivated. Ability to effectively manage staff to maintain a high level of morale and productivity. Ability to work well under pressure. Strong irrigation repair knowledge will be a key factor. E-Mail resumes ONLY. |
